Abstract:
Embodiments described herein are related to performing virtual application delivery. In some embodiments, a method includes accessing, at a computing device, a datastore comprising a first virtual disk file mapped to a plurality of virtual disk files separate from the first virtual disk file, wherein each of the plurality of virtual disk files comprises at least one application stored thereon. The method further includes receiving, at the computing device, one or more operations for accessing the first virtual disk file, the one or more operations corresponding to a first application stored on a second virtual disk file of the plurality of virtual disk files. The method further includes redirecting the one or more operations for accessing the first virtual disk file to the second virtual disk file.
